Andersen's fairy tales have always been a source of inspiration for European and American animations. Like Disney's annual blockbuster "Frozen", the Russian animated film "The Snow Queen" is also based on "The Snow Queen". This 3D animated film will be released nationwide on August 3. Recently, the official released a dubbing special, and finally revealed its dubbing lineup. Liu Chunyan, who has dubbed classic cartoons such as "Doraemon" and "Big Head Son and Little Head Father", will work with the powerful singer-songwriter Huo Zun who sang "Rolling Pearl Curtain" to play a pair of siblings. Jin Wei, a famous host of Oriental Satellite TV, plays the monster Orm. They will jointly perform this animated film adapted from Andersen's classic fairy tale.

The Snow Queen tells the story of a little girl named Gerda who stands up to the Snow Queen in order to save her brother Kai. As the largest animation series in Russia, the project of The Snow Queen was launched earlier than Disney's Frozen, and it is more faithful to restore the essence of the classic original. It is reported that the film will be distributed by China Film Distribution Co., Ltd. and has been officially scheduled to be released nationwide on August 3.

The Scarab falls in love with his sister Gerda

Liu Chunyan, the "Golden Beetle" who has accompanied several generations in the program "Big Windmill", voiced the elder sister Gerda in "The Snow Queen". In fact, long before she became a host of children's programs, Golden Beetle was a professional voice actor. She began to voice many animation characters when she was nine years old. The familiar Doraemon, Big Head Son, Astro Boy and Minnie in "Mickey Mouse" all came from her versatile interpretation.

Although she has performed countless classic roles, it has been a long time since "Jinguizi" dubbed a cute little girl character. Finally, she got to voice the elder sister Gerda in "The Snow Queen". "Jinguizi" thinks that the brave and kind Gerda is one of her favorite roles in her entire dubbing career: "I haven't dubbed such a beautiful elder sister for a long, long time. The beautiful voice of elder sister Gerda is my favorite. I had a great time dubbing this time and I really want to do it again."

Huo Zun makes his dubbing debut in "Rolling Pearl Curtain"

Huo Zun, a new generation singer-songwriter who is well-known for his original song "Rolling Pearl Curtain", voiced the younger brother Kai in the film. This was Huo Zun's first time to voice a character in an animated film. In the familiar recording studio, Huo Zun's first dubbing work was completed smoothly. "Jinguizi", who played the role of sister Gerda, praised Huo Zun's warm and unique voice. The chemistry between the siblings was wonderful.

In Huo Zun's eyes, Kai is a typical literary child: "He uses his paintbrush to warm people's hearts. He is quiet but powerful, weak but fearless." Huo Zun was reluctant to leave for his first dubbing experience: "Although dubbing is completely different from singing in the recording studio, the melody of music is completely different from the performance of language. It is really not an easy task to blend into the role. Fortunately, I have the director's careful guidance." The first attempt made Huo Zun fall in love with dubbing, and he can't wait to dub the second part of the "Snow Queen" series.

"Brother Jin Wei" sacrifices his image to star in "Warcraft"

The amiable "Brother Jin Wei" in Oriental TV's "Trendy Kids" made a "sacrifice" of his image this time. In "The Snow Queen", he voiced the monster Orm, who played a "key role" in the film's plot. He caused a lot of trouble to his sister Gerda and his brother Kai and also affected the film's ending.

When the producers first invited "Brother Jin Wei" to do the dubbing, he was worried about whether his "special" voice would be suitable for the role. But after watching the sample reel, "Brother Jin Wei" praised the producers for their "vision", because his voice is a perfect match for Om the Beast: "In the eyes of children across the country, I am a big brother full of positive energy, but the strange voice of Om the Beast is too suitable for my voice. After the dubbing, maybe everyone will think this character is very handsome and cute." Jin Wei hopes that audiences across the country can come together to feel the sunshine, love and positive energy conveyed by the film.

The Snow Queen was produced by Wizart, the top animation company in Russia. Different from the stereotyped Hollywood animation, The Snow Queen uses the world's top 3D animation technology to present the unique charm of European classical fairy tales. The Snow Queen has been released in more than 80 countries around the world since its premiere, and the Chinese dubbing version performed by "Jinguizi", Huo Zun and "Brother Jin Wei" will be released at the same time as the original English version, which is expected to help The Snow Queen continue to detonate the mainland summer season as a representative of the animation film camp after "The Return of the Great Sage".
